Transaction 423aedea1551dfc06015b5eff1cdaa40028317bb13a8a30c8b456d2e539c463e

1 Input
2 Outputs
  • 423aedea1551dfc06015b5eff1cdaa40028317bb13a8a30c8b456d2e539c463e:0
  • value  2426841
    address  3J6Vcy6rPCiDFoKVyDAkCtuaFVPMDu8Cmm
  • 423aedea1551dfc06015b5eff1cdaa40028317bb13a8a30c8b456d2e539c463e:1
  • value  24206867
    address  37UcTdpK2kTH1PfVS9BJXspvg2g11VrUkW